Roadside Assistance

I have Progressive insurance for my RV. Was looking at my policy and saw I have RA. I also have Coach Net. Coverage looks the same. Anyone use Progressive RA, Should I drop Coach Net.

Ken
  • Had progressive for several years with a Class "C"

    During that time they changed 2 tires,
    and towed to facility twice to replace fuel pumps, once including a car carrier I was towing with a PU on it. They covered the towing for both, which included 2 trips.

    Currently using Geico Roadside Assistance for the Motorhome. Made arrangements to come to site to repair flat. They reimbursed full cost of onsite repair including taxes.

    The only issue I had with Geico was they wanted to tow me to have the repair made. I chose to use an onsite service, and received fast reimbursement.

    I don't use any major RA company anymore. I have had both GS and CN over the years. They won't tow if involved in an accident, insurance will.

    My insurance covers both events at a less expensive rate.

    That's my choice, and has worked for me, others mileage may not be the same.
